Admissions Policy<br />

Application for entry to Ysgol <strong>Eirias</strong> for the<br />

academic year 2011/12.<br />

Application for entry to Ysgol <strong>Eirias</strong> for September<br />

2011 should be made by completing the<br />

application form provided. The number of<br />

intended admissions for this year’s entry is 248. For<br />

information on Admissions you can contact our<br />

Admissions Officer Mrs Thomas through Reception.<br />

Where applications exceed the number of<br />

places available, certain criteria contained in the<br />

Admissions Policy Document will be applied to<br />

determine admission. Copy available on request.<br />

Where admission has not been possible, parents<br />

or guardians may appeal through the Appeals<br />

Committee which consists of an independent<br />

panel.<br />

Sixth Form<br />

For students wishing to access courses at Ysgol<br />

<strong>Eirias</strong> Sixth Form, you must meet certain entry<br />

requirements.<br />

The criteria is published in the Sixth Form<br />

prospectus which is available on request. In all<br />

cases a good attendance record during KS4<br />

education is expected.<br />

Student Manager<br />

Our Student Manager is Ms Joanna Dixon whose<br />

role includes supporting Heads of Learning and<br />

Deputy Heads with student pastoral aspects such<br />

as uniform, punctuality and attendance. Ms Dixon<br />

supervises the school referral area dealing with<br />

student behavioural, social and medical issues<br />

and relaying this information to parents where<br />

appropriate. If you wish to make an appointment<br />

with Ms Dixon regarding any issues, these can be<br />

made through Reception.<br />

Absences<br />

In the event of a student’s absence you should<br />

inform the school office by telephone on a<br />

daily basis. This should be followed by a note<br />

of explanation in the student planner when the<br />

student returns to school.<br />

If a long absence seems likely we may be able to<br />

arrange for home study. We also require a note<br />

if parents wish their child to leave the premises<br />

during normal school hours.<br />

Our Attendance Officer is Mrs Humphries who<br />

you can contact through the <strong>School</strong> Reception.
